Hi everyone, I'm new to the forum as am I new with my FRS. This is going to be the first vehicle I've owned that I have the ability to modify outside of cosmetics and doing self maintenance.
I am interested in what some good starter mods would be for my 13 FRS. Nothing too crazy or pricey from the start, just things that make the overall drive more enjoyable. If its things I can do at home/on my weekends that's a huge plus.
Hi ya DabbinTooHard , congratulations on your purchase and welcome to ye ol forum -

As far as "making the overall drive more enjoyable", just about anything you do to that car isn't going to make the drive more enjoyable, for average driving.

FI will make it less dependable.

Flex fuel will make it more expensive to drive.

Changing the suspension will usually make for a rougher ride.

Changing the exhaust will make the car noisier in the cabin.

Before you change the tune to reduce the torque dip, ask yourself "does that really bother me?"

Changing the tires (except for getting winter tires) will have drawbacks, for average driving.

Change the wheels? Why? Do you think they are ugly?
